Information and Instructions for Filing a Petition for a Writ of Habeas Corpus - 2254 (by a Person in State Custody)

Connecticut Information and Instructions for Filing a Petition for a Writ of Habeas Corpus — 2254 (by a Person in State Custody) is a legal document which sets out the procedure for a person in state custody to petition a court for a writ of habeas corpus. This type of writ is used to challenge the legality of a person’s confinement or detention. The document provides information about the legal requirements necessary for filing a petition for a writ of habeas corpus with the court. It includes detailed instructions for completing the petition form, as well as information about the fees associated with the filing and other procedures associated with the writ. It also provides information regarding the filing of a motion to stay, which is a request for the court to temporarily suspend the enforcement of an order or ruling. The Connecticut Information and Instructions for Filing a Petition for a Writ of Habeas Corpus — 2254 (by a Person in State Custody) includes two types of documents: a Petition for Writ of Habeas Corpus and an Order for Hearing. The Petition for Writ of Habeas Corpus provides the court with an overview of the legal basis for the challenge to the person’s confinement or detention, as well as relevant facts and arguments. The Order for Hearing is an order issued by the court which sets a date and time for the hearing on the petition. A 2254 petition is a specific type of writ of habeas corpus, named after the section of the U.S. Code that governs its use. This petition allows state prisoners to seek federal review of their confinement. It is typically used when a person believes their constitutional rights have been violated. The grounds for filing a habeas corpus petition can vary but often include issues such as a lack of jurisdiction, the violation of due process rights, or constitutional violations during the trial process. Each ground must be clearly articulated in your petition for it to be considered valid.
